Let’s start with the basics. The lighting systems on an SPMT serve a few key functions. First off, they’re all about safety. When you’re moving a huge load, visibility is everything. Whether it’s during the day or at night, the right lights can help prevent accidents and keep everyone on the job site safe.

One of the most important types of lights on an SPMT is the headlight. These are the big, bright lights at the front of the vehicle. They’re designed to illuminate the path ahead, especially in low – light conditions. You know, when you’re working at night or in a dimly – lit warehouse. The headlights on an SPMT need to be really powerful because they have to light up a large area in front of this massive machine. They’re not like regular car headlights; they have to cover a much wider and longer range. Some of the high – end SPMTs have adjustable headlights. This means that you can change the angle and the spread of the light depending on the situation. For example, if you’re moving in a narrow space, you can adjust the headlights to focus more narrowly. If you’re on an open road, you can widen the beam to see more of the area around you.

Then there are the taillights. Taillights are super important for signaling to other vehicles and people behind the SPMT. They let others know when the SPMT is stopping, turning, or just moving. The red taillights are always on when the SPMT is in operation, so that other people can easily spot it from the back. When the driver hits the brakes, the taillights get brighter, giving a clear signal to anyone following that the vehicle is slowing down. And the turn signals on the taillights are also crucial. They flash either left or right to let others know which direction the SPMT is going to turn. This is really important, especially when you’re moving a huge load that might block the view of other drivers.

Side marker lights are another essential part of the lighting system. These are the small lights along the sides of the SPMT. They help to define the width of the vehicle, which is really important because SPMTs can be extremely wide. When other vehicles are passing by or when you’re maneuvering in a tight space, the side marker lights make it clear how much room the SPMT takes up. They’re usually amber in color and are spaced out evenly along the sides of the vehicle.

In addition to these basic lights, many SPMTs also have work lights. Work lights are used when you need to illuminate a specific area around the vehicle, like when you’re loading or unloading a heavy object. These lights can be mounted on different parts of the SPMT, such as the sides, the front, or even on top. They can be adjusted to shine in different directions, so you can focus the light exactly where you need it. Some work lights are really powerful, almost like spotlights. They can turn a dark work area into a well – lit space in an instant.

Now, let’s talk about the technology behind these lighting systems. Most modern SPMTs use LED lights. LED lights have a bunch of advantages over traditional incandescent or halogen lights. First of all, they’re much more energy – efficient. This is a big deal because SPMTs use a lot of power to move those heavy loads, and using energy – efficient lights helps to reduce the overall power consumption. LED lights also last a lot longer. You don’t have to replace them as often as traditional lights, which means less maintenance and lower costs in the long run. They’re also more durable. They can withstand the vibrations and shocks that an SPMT experiences during operation better than other types of lights.

Another cool thing about the lighting systems on SPMTs is that they can be integrated with the vehicle’s control system. This means that the lights can be controlled automatically based on the vehicle’s speed, direction, or other factors. For example, when the SPMT is moving slowly, the headlights might adjust to a lower beam to save energy. When the vehicle is turning, the side lights on the turning side might flash in a special pattern to give an extra warning to others.

But it’s not all about the technology. The design of the lighting system also matters. The lights need to be placed in the right positions to be effective. For example, the headlights need to be high enough to avoid being blocked by the load but also low enough to provide a good view of the road. The taillights need to be visible from different angles, so they’re usually placed at the rear corners of the vehicle. And the side marker lights need to be evenly spaced to give a clear indication of the vehicle’s width.
